+package com.android.internal.util;
+
+import org.xmlpull.v1.XmlSerializer;
+
+import java.io.IOException;
+import java.io.OutputStream;
+import java.io.OutputStreamWriter;
+import java.io.UnsupportedEncodingException;
+import java.io.Writer;
+import java.nio.ByteBuffer;
+import java.nio.CharBuffer;
+import java.nio.charset.Charset;
+import java.nio.charset.CharsetEncoder;
+import java.nio.charset.CoderResult;
+import java.nio.charset.IllegalCharsetNameException;
+import java.nio.charset.UnsupportedCharsetException;
+
+/**
+ * This is a quick and dirty implementation of XmlSerializer that isn't horribly
+ * painfully slow like the normal one. It only does what is needed for the
+ * specific XML files being written with it.
+ */
+public class FastXmlSerializer implements XmlSerializer {
+ private static final String ESCAPE_TABLE[] = new String[] {
+ null, null, null, null, null, null, null, null, // 0-7
+ null, null, null, null, null, null, null, null, // 8-15
+ null, null, null, null, null, null, null, null, // 16-23
+ null, null, null, null, null, null, null, null, // 24-31
+ null, null, """, null, null, null, "&", null, // 32-39
+ null, null, null, null, null, null, null, null, // 40-47
+ null, null, null, null, null, null, null, null, // 48-55
+ null, null, null, null, "<", null, ">", null, // 56-63
+ };
+
+ private static final int BUFFER_LEN = 8192;
+
+ private final char[] mText = new char[BUFFER_LEN];
+ private int mPos;
+
+ private Writer mWriter;
+
+ private OutputStream mOutputStream;
+ private CharsetEncoder mCharset;
+ private ByteBuffer mBytes = ByteBuffer.allocate(BUFFER_LEN);
+
+ private boolean mInTag;
+
+ private void append(char c) throws IOException {
+ int pos = mPos;
+ if (pos >= (BUFFER_LEN-1)) {
+ flush();
+ pos = mPos;
+ }
+ mText[pos] = c;
+ mPos = pos+1;
+ }
+
+ private void append(String str, int i, final int length) throws IOException {
+ if (length > BUFFER_LEN) {
+ final int end = i + length;
+ while (i < end) {
+ int next = i + BUFFER_LEN;
+ append(str, i, next<end ? BUFFER_LEN : (end-i));
+ i = next;
+ }
+ return;
+ }
+ int pos = mPos;
+ if ((pos+length) > BUFFER_LEN) {
+ flush();
+ pos = mPos;
+ }
+ str.getChars(i, i+length, mText, pos);
+ mPos = pos + length;
+ }
+
+ private void append(char[] buf, int i, final int length) throws IOException {
+ if (length > BUFFER_LEN) {
+ final int end = i + length;
+ while (i < end) {
+ int next = i + BUFFER_LEN;
+ append(buf, i, next<end ? BUFFER_LEN : (end-i));
+ i = next;
+ }
+ return;
+ }
+ int pos = mPos;
+ if ((pos+length) > BUFFER_LEN) {
+ flush();
+ pos = mPos;
+ }
+ System.arraycopy(buf, i, mText, pos, length);
+ mPos = pos + length;
+ }
+
+ private void append(String str) throws IOException {
+ append(str, 0, str.length());
+ }
+
+ private void escapeAndAppendString(final String string) throws IOException {
+ final int N = string.length();
+ final char NE = (char)ESCAPE_TABLE.length;
+ final String[] escapes = ESCAPE_TABLE;
+ int lastPos = 0;
+ int pos;
+ for (pos=0; pos<N; pos++) {
+ char c = string.charAt(pos);
+ if (c >= NE) continue;
+ String escape = escapes[c];
+ if (escape == null) continue;
+ if (lastPos < pos) append(string, lastPos, pos-lastPos);
+ lastPos = pos + 1;
+ append(escape);
+ }
+ if (lastPos < pos) append(string, lastPos, pos-lastPos);
+ }
+
+ private void escapeAndAppendString(char[] buf, int start, int len) throws IOException {
+ final char NE = (char)ESCAPE_TABLE.length;
+ final String[] escapes = ESCAPE_TABLE;
+ int end = start+len;
+ int lastPos = start;
+ int pos;
+ for (pos=start; pos<end; pos++) {
+ char c = buf[pos];
+ if (c >= NE) continue;
+ String escape = escapes[c];
+ if (escape == null) continue;
+ if (lastPos < pos) append(buf, lastPos, pos-lastPos);
+ lastPos = pos + 1;
+ append(escape);
+ }
+ if (lastPos < pos) append(buf, lastPos, pos-lastPos);
+ }
